.page-wrap.svelte-1g4xivj.svelte-1g4xivj{min-height:100vh;background:var(--bg)}.nav-wrap.svelte-1g4xivj.svelte-1g4xivj{max-width:780px;margin:0 auto;padding:0 20px}.main.svelte-1g4xivj.svelte-1g4xivj{max-width:780px;margin:0 auto;padding:0 20px 80px}.breadcrumb.svelte-1g4xivj.svelte-1g4xivj{display:flex;align-items:center;gap:8px;flex-wrap:wrap;font-size:12px;color:var(--text);opacity:.5;padding:20px 0 28px;font-family:var(--font-display);font-weight:600}.breadcrumb.svelte-1g4xivj a.svelte-1g4xivj{color:inherit;text-decoration:none}.breadcrumb.svelte-1g4xivj a.svelte-1g4xivj:hover{opacity:1;color:var(--blue-deep)}.bc-current.svelte-1g4xivj.svelte-1g4xivj{opacity:.7}.article-card.svelte-1g4xivj.svelte-1g4xivj{background:var(--paper);border-radius:24px;box-shadow:var(--raise);padding:0;margin-bottom:32px;overflow:hidden}.art-hero.svelte-1g4xivj.svelte-1g4xivj{position:relative;height:300px}.art-hero-img.svelte-1g4xivj.svelte-1g4xivj{width:100%;height:100%;object-fit:cover;display:block}.art-hero-overlay.svelte-1g4xivj.svelte-1g4xivj{position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(to bottom,transparent 50%,rgba(230,234,244,.7) 100%)}.art-header.svelte-1g4xivj.svelte-1g4xivj{margin-bottom:36px;border-bottom:1px solid rgba(163,177,210,.15);padding:36px 52px 28px}.art-meta.svelte-1g4xivj.svelte-1g4xivj{display:flex;align-items:center;gap:8px;font-size:12px;opacity:.5;font-family:var(--font-display);font-weight:600;margin-bottom:16px}.meta-dot.svelte-1g4xivj.svelte-1g4xivj{opacity:.4}.art-title.svelte-1g4xivj.svelte-1g4xivj{font-family:var(--font-display);font-size:clamp(22px,3.5vw,34px);font-weight:900;color:var(--text);line-height:1.3;text-shadow:2px 2px 4px var(--light),-1px -1px 3px var(--dark);margin:0 0 16px}.art-excerpt.svelte-1g4xivj.svelte-1g4xivj{font-size:16px;color:var(--text);opacity:.6;line-height:1.65;margin:0}.art-body.svelte-1g4xivj.svelte-1g4xivj{padding:0 52px 48px}.art-body.svelte-1g4xivj h2{font-family:var(--font-display);font-size:20px;font-weight:800;color:var(--text);margin:36px 0 14px;letter-spacing:.02em}.art-body.svelte-1g4xivj h3{font-family:var(--font-display);font-size:16px;font-weight:700;color:var(--text);margin:28px 0 10px}.art-body.svelte-1g4xivj p{font-size:15.5px;line-height:1.75;color:var(--text);opacity:.8;margin:0 0 18px}.art-body.svelte-1g4xivj ul,.art-body.svelte-1g4xivj ol{margin:0 0 18px 22px;padding:0}.art-body.svelte-1g4xivj li{font-size:15.5px;line-height:1.7;color:var(--text);opacity:.8;margin-bottom:6px}.art-body.svelte-1g4xivj strong{color:var(--text);opacity:1;font-weight:700}.art-body.svelte-1g4xivj blockquote{border-left:3px solid var(--blue-deep);padding:12px 20px;margin:24px 0;background:#6482c80d;border-radius:0 12px 12px 0}.art-body.svelte-1g4xivj blockquote p{margin:0;font-style:italic}.art-body.svelte-1g4xivj code{font-family:Courier New,monospace;font-size:13px;background:#a3b1d226;padding:2px 6px;border-radius:4px}.related.svelte-1g4xivj.svelte-1g4xivj{margin-bottom:32px}.related-title.svelte-1g4xivj.svelte-1g4xivj{font-family:var(--font-display);font-size:13px;font-weight:800;letter-spacing:.1em;color:var(--text);opacity:.5;margin:0 0 16px;text-transform:uppercase}.related-grid.svelte-1g4xivj.svelte-1g4xivj{display:grid;grid-template-columns:repeat(auto-fill,minmax(220px,1fr));gap:16px}.rel-card.svelte-1g4xivj.svelte-1g4xivj{background:var(--paper);border-radius:16px;box-shadow:var(--raise-sm);padding:20px;text-decoration:none;color:inherit;transition:box-shadow .15s,transform .12s}.rel-card.svelte-1g4xivj.svelte-1g4xivj:hover{box-shadow:var(--raise);transform:translateY(-1px)}.rel-date.svelte-1g4xivj.svelte-1g4xivj{font-size:11px;opacity:.4;font-family:var(--font-display);font-weight:600;margin-bottom:8px}.rel-title.svelte-1g4xivj.svelte-1g4xivj{font-size:14px;font-family:var(--font-display);font-weight:700;line-height:1.4}.cta-card.svelte-1g4xivj.svelte-1g4xivj{background:var(--paper);border-radius:20px;box-shadow:var(--raise);padding:36px 40px;text-align:center}.cta-label.svelte-1g4xivj.svelte-1g4xivj{font-family:var(--font-display);font-size:10px;font-weight:800;letter-spacing:.18em;color:var(--blue-deep);opacity:.7;margin-bottom:10px}.cta-title.svelte-1g4xivj.svelte-1g4xivj{font-family:var(--font-display);font-size:22px;font-weight:900;color:var(--text);margin-bottom:12px}.cta-body.svelte-1g4xivj.svelte-1g4xivj{font-size:14.5px;opacity:.6;line-height:1.6;margin-bottom:24px}.cta-btn.svelte-1g4xivj.svelte-1g4xivj{display:inline-block;background:var(--blue-deep);color:#fff;padding:13px 28px;border-radius:12px;text-decoration:none;font-family:var(--font-display);font-weight:800;font-size:14px;letter-spacing:.05em;transition:opacity .15s}.cta-btn.svelte-1g4xivj.svelte-1g4xivj:hover{opacity:.88}.footer.svelte-1g4xivj.svelte-1g4xivj{text-align:center;padding:32px 20px;font-size:11px;color:var(--text);opacity:.4;line-height:1.6;border-top:1px solid rgba(163,177,210,.12);margin-top:48px}@media (max-width: 640px){.art-hero.svelte-1g4xivj.svelte-1g4xivj{height:200px}.art-header.svelte-1g4xivj.svelte-1g4xivj{padding:24px 22px 20px}.art-body.svelte-1g4xivj.svelte-1g4xivj{padding:0 22px 32px}.related-grid.svelte-1g4xivj.svelte-1g4xivj{grid-template-columns:1fr}.cta-card.svelte-1g4xivj.svelte-1g4xivj{padding:28px 22px}}
